首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何检查typescript中的文字。不工作的实例

在 TypeScript 中检查文字的方法是使用类型注解和类型推断来确保变量的类型正确。以下是一些常见的方法:

  1. 使用类型注解:在声明变量时,可以使用类型注解来指定变量的类型。例如,可以使用 : string 来指定一个变量的类型为字符串。示例代码如下:
代码语言:txt
复制
let text: string = "Hello, TypeScript!";
  1. 使用类型推断:TypeScript 可以根据变量的赋值推断出其类型。例如,如果将一个字符串赋值给一个变量,TypeScript 将自动推断该变量的类型为字符串。示例代码如下:
代码语言:txt
复制
let text = "Hello, TypeScript!"; // TypeScript 推断 text 的类型为字符串
  1. 使用类型保护:可以使用类型保护来在运行时检查变量的类型。例如,可以使用 typeof 操作符来检查变量的类型是否为字符串。示例代码如下:
代码语言:txt
复制
function isString(text: unknown): text is string {
  return typeof text === "string";
}

let value: unknown = "Hello, TypeScript!";
if (isString(value)) {
  // 在这个块中,TypeScript 将 value 的类型视为字符串
  console.log(value.toUpperCase());
}
  1. 使用类型断言:可以使用类型断言来告诉 TypeScript 变量的确切类型。类型断言使用 as 关键字。示例代码如下:
代码语言:txt
复制
let text: unknown = "Hello, TypeScript!";
let length = (text as string).length;

这些方法可以帮助您在 TypeScript 中检查文字的类型和确保类型的正确性。对于更复杂的文字检查需求,您可以使用 TypeScript 的高级类型系统和类型操作符来实现。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券